At the core of the shell mold casting technique is the use of a two-part mold made from a thin layer of sand mixed with a resin binder. This combination is heated to form a solid mold that can withstand high temperatures during the pouring process. The process begins with the preparation of the shell mold. A metal pattern, typically made of aluminum or steel, is heated and coated with a mixture of sand and resin. This allows the sand to adhere to the pattern, forming a shell that can be easily removed once cured. The two halves of the shell are then assembled to create a complete mold cavity. Liquid metal is poured into this cavity, filling it and taking on the shape of the pattern. Upon cooling, the mold is broken away, revealing the final product.
